Understanding the Evolving Educational Landscape

The first step in grasping the complexities of global education policy is to understand the current trends and challenges. In recent years, there has been a significant shift towards digital learning and technology integration. With advancements in AI, virtual reality, and augmented reality, educational institutions are exploring new ways to enhance teaching and learning experiences. However, the rapid adoption of digital tools has also raised concerns about digital literacy, data privacy, and equity in access to technology.

# 1. Digital Transformation in Education

One of the most notable trends is the digital transformation of education. Schools and universities around the world are increasingly adopting online platforms and digital resources to cater to a diverse range of learners. According to a report by the UNESCO Institute for Statistics, the number of students enrolled in online courses has surged, reflecting a growing acceptance of blended learning models.

However, the digital divide remains a significant challenge. Students from underprivileged backgrounds often lack access to the necessary technology and internet connectivity, exacerbating existing inequalities. # 2. Sustainability and Environmental Education

Another key trend is the increasing emphasis on sustainability and environmental education. Climate change and environmental issues are no longer peripheral concerns but central to the education agenda. Educational institutions are incorporating sustainability into their curricula, teaching students about the importance of environmental stewardship and sustainable practices.

For instance, some universities have implemented green campus initiatives, such as solar panels, green roofs, and waste reduction programs. Innovations in Teaching and Learning

Innovations in teaching and learning are transforming the way we approach education. From gamification to project-based learning, these new methods are designed to engage students and foster critical thinking and problem-solving skills.

# 3. Gamification in the Classroom

Gamification involves using game design elements in non-game contexts to enhance learning experiences. This approach can make learning more engaging and interactive. For example, educational apps and games can help students develop their skills in a fun and interactive way. # 4. Project-Based Learning

Project-based learning (PBL) is another innovative approach that emphasizes hands-on, real-world problem-solving. This method encourages students to work collaboratively and apply their knowledge to solve complex issues. PBL can be particularly effective in developing critical thinking, communication, and collaboration skills.
